The Perverts Guide To Cinema Review
Slavoj Zizek, a psychologist, gives an indepth view of psychology in cinema, in this documentary. It goes way back to 1931 with the movie Possessed, to Mullholland Drive, and discusses subjects such as the Oedipus scenario in The Birds, and other Fruedian analysis of the Three Levels Of Subjectivity, the Id, Ego and Superego in Psycho, and The Marx Bros.
It was quite interesting to see this new angle on cinema. It makes you want to psychoanalyse everything you see from now on.
